DID YOU KNOW...

  • 1.5 million Americans suffer fractures due to weak bones?
  • Half of all women over age 50 will have an osteoporosis-related fractures?
  • Four times as many men and nearly three times as many women have Osteoporosis than report having the disease?
  • Half of all Americans over 50 will have weak bones and low bone mass by 2020 at current growth rates?
  • Medical expenses from osteoporosis-related bone fractures costs $18 billion annually?
  • The number of hip fractures in the United States can double or even triple by 2040?
  • The most common breaks in weak bones are in the: Wrist, Spine and Hip?
  • The cost of a hip fracture can be more than $81,000 during their lifetime?
  • One in five elderly people die within a year of the hip fracture?
  • One in four become disabled?
  • One in five must move to a nursing home within a year?

In its role as a bone health supplement, OsteoDenx helps support a range of physical and systemic activities that are necessary to sustain life. The skeleton is a structural framework that provides flexibility and enables motion.

It serves as protective armor for major organs including the heart, lungs, liver and brain. Yet our bone chemistry also contributes to a variety of internal functions.

Bony tissue is a chemical storehouse, serving as a repository for essential minerals. It contains 99% of the body's calcium and releases amounts of this element as needed to assist in heart, muscle and nerve action.

Bone marrow is a blood generator. Its produces red blood cells, necessary for transforming oxygen from the lungs to tissues throughout the body. Marrow synthesizes white blood cells that help fight off infection and platelets which enable blood to clot and assist in rejuvenation and recovery.

Healthy bones are also a factor in preserving healthy joints, promoting the retention of cartilage and synovial fluid that keep the joint lubricated and cushioned against shock.
